The Coulomb dissociation of 27P was studied experimentally using 27P beams at 57 MeV/nucleon with a lead target. The gamma decay width of the first excited state in 27P was extracted for astrophysical interest. A preliminary result is consistent with the value estimated on the basis of a shell model calculation by Caggiano et al.
